Parallel beam generation method for a high-precision roll angle measurement with a long working distance.

Wenran Ren, Jiwen Cui, Jiubin Tan

    Optics Express
    |November 13, 2020
    PubMed
    Summary

    This study introduces a new system for precise roll angle measurement over long distances using two parallel light beams and detectors. Experiments confirm its effectiveness, achieving high accuracy and resolution for demanding applications.

    Area of Science:

    • Optics and Measurement Science
    • Precision Engineering

    Background:

    • Accurate roll angle measurement is crucial in various engineering fields.
    • Existing methods often face limitations in achieving high precision over long working distances.

    Purpose of the Study:

    • To present a novel measurement system for high-precision roll angle determination.
    • To enable accurate measurements over extended working distances.

    Main Methods:

    • Development of a measurement system comprising a light source and detector components.
    • Utilizing a transmission grating and plane mirror to generate two high-precision parallel beams.
    • Implementing a design to minimize beam nonparallelism caused by installation errors.

    Main Results:

    • Demonstrated effectiveness of the measurement system through experimental validation.
    • Achieved a resolution of 0.5 arcseconds.
    • Attained a measurement accuracy of 1.1 arcseconds.

    Conclusions:

    • The novel system provides a robust solution for high-precision roll angle measurements.
    • The design effectively addresses challenges associated with long working distances and installation errors.
    • The experimental results validate the system's capability for precise angular metrology.
